SEDATIVES AND HYPNOTICS Meaning and Definition

  1. Sedatives and hypnotics are a class of drugs commonly used to induce relaxation, calmness, and sleepiness in individuals. They are primarily employed to alleviate symptoms of anxiety, insomnia, and certain psychological disorders. These substances act upon the central nervous system to slow down brain activity, resulting in a sedative effect.

    Sedatives refer to medications that promote relaxation and decrease irritability, excitability, or agitation. They work by depressing the central nervous system's activity, thus producing a calming and soothing effect on the body and mind. Sedatives are often prescribed to manage anxiety, muscle spasms, and to help individuals cope with high-stress situations. Some commonly used sedatives include benzodiazepines, barbiturates, and certain antihistamines.

    Hypnotics, on the other hand, are substances specifically used to induce sleep. They act on the brain's sleep-promoting pathways to facilitate the process of falling asleep and maintaining sleep throughout the night. Hypnotic medications are commonly prescribed for individuals suffering from insomnia or other sleep disorders. Examples of hypnotics include zolpidem, eszopiclone, and other non-benzodiazepine sedative-hypnotics.

    Both sedatives and hypnotics carry potential risks and side effects, including drowsiness, impaired coordination, memory difficulties, and dependence with long-term use. Therefore, the use of these medications should always be regulated and monitored under the guidance of a healthcare professional. It is vital to follow the prescribed dosage and duration to ensure optimal benefits while minimizing the potential for adverse effects.
